Our Radon Testing Process — From Phone Call to Closing
The top Radon Testing Near Me Loudonville process is deliberately simple. Five steps, no surprises.
- Call or book online. Tell us the property address, the reason for the test, and — if applicable — your closing date. We confirm pricing on the phone.
- Deployment. A licensed technician arrives at the Loudonville property, places a calibrated continuous radon monitor in the lowest livable level, verifies closed-house conditions, and documents the deployment.
- 48-hour minimum monitoring. The device records radon levels hourly. We do not use mail-in charcoal kits for transactions — the data isn't granular enough to defend in a deal.
- Retrieval and reporting. The technician retrieves the device, downloads the data, and we issue a signed PDF report — usually within 24 hours, often the same day.
- Next steps. If the result is below 4.0 pCi/L, you're done — keep the report for disclosure. If it's above 4.0 pCi/L, we quote a permanent, code-compliant mitigation system with a guaranteed post-install reading below 4.0 pCi/L.
Local Expertise: Radon in Loudonville and Ashland County
Loudonville's housing stock is unusually varied for a town its size — historic homes near Main Street and Central Park, mid-century ranches off Wally Road, newer builds toward Perrysville, and cabins and second homes throughout the Mohican area. Each construction type has its own radon entry profile.
Older homes with stone or rubble foundations leak radon through every joint and crack. Slab-on-grade builds often pull radon up through plumbing penetrations and control joints. Walkout basements built into the hillsides around the Mohican State Forest can produce dramatically different readings on the upper and lower levels of the same house. We've tested all of these. We know where to place the monitor, what closed-house conditions actually mean in a drafty 1920s farmhouse, and how to mitigate without tearing up finished basements.
Ashland County, Holmes County, Richland County, and Knox County all sit in EPA Radon Zone 1. Ohio Department of Health data consistently shows this region produces a high percentage of homes above the 4.0 pCi/L action level. That's not unusual — it's the rule, not the exception. Pricing, Pricing Transparency, and What to Expect
One of the most common complaints we hear about other radon companies: 'Every company wants me to call for a price — just tell me what it costs.' Fair. Here's the honest answer.
- Standard residential real estate test (single-family, one device): typically $150–$200 in the Loudonville market.
- Peace-of-mind homeowner test: often less, depending on scheduling flexibility.
- Commercial / multi-family testing: quoted per device based on square footage and AARST protocol requirements.
- Mitigation system installation: typical range $1,200–$2,500 for a standard sub-slab depressurization system, with permanent code-compliant design and a guarantee the post-mitigation reading will be below 4.0 pCi/L.
Pricing varies with access, foundation type, and timeline. We confirm the exact number before we deploy — never after.
